World’s Architectural Community Gathers in Barcelona
The best that global architecture has to offer will be on show this
week at World Architecture Festival, a unique event celebrating the
world's finest work from the world's greatest architects. The
festival starts today (Wednesday 22nd October) and runs until Friday
24th October at the CCIB International Conference Centre in
Barcelona.
World Architecture Festival is set to become one of the most
significant dates in the global architectural calendar.
At the heart of the Festival is the World Architecture Festival
Awards (WAF Awards), the biggest architectural awards programme in
the world, which celebrates the work, concerns and aspirations of
the international architectural community. It is the biggest
architectural awards programme in the world, which looks beyond
borders to celebrate the finest work from the world’s greatest
architects.
Over 2,000 delegates attending the Festival from 66 countries, have
access to something previously reserved for a select few - the
opportunity to hear and see a shortlist of 224 architects from 42
countries present their schemes to a panel of expert judges.
A star studded super jury of distinguished architects and renowned
industry figures from around the world has been lined up to judge
the WAF Awards. Each of the 17 category winners announced during the
Festival will compete against each other to win the ultimate best in
show prize, the World Building of the Year. The winner will be
announced at the end of the Festival by Lord (Norman) Foster at a
glittering Awards ceremony on Friday 24th October.
Throughout the Festival delegates will be able to view all 722 Award
entries from 63 countries in the Awards Entry Gallery and listen to
the shortlisted candidates explain the challenges they faced in
creating their vision.

Alongside the Awards presentations, the Festival programme is made
up of six seminars each day, ending with a keynote address from
prominent architectural figures. In many sessions the debate will be
thrown open to the floor for discussion with audience not only of
architects, but students, critics, policy makers and their
influencers, providing a unique and comprehensive insight into many
of the critical issues affecting the industry.

Delegates will also be able to visit a thematic exhibition and
seminar on ‘Height – Between Possibility and Responsibility’. The
exhibition examines the relationship between architecture and the
factors which influence the creation of tall structures. It takes 12
tower designs from around the world, designed to take into account a
series of differing context: climate, cost, energy, and social
conditions.
In search of the ‘starchitects’ of the future, six architectural
schools from around the globe will be competing at the World
Architecture Festival (WAF) student charrette, where they will have
just 36 hours to redesign a brownfield site in Barcelona. The two
day charrette is themed around the use of water to revitalise a
forgotten site in the city and takes place from 22nd to 23rd
October. Each school will be briefed to redevelop a large redundant
industrial complex in the Barcelona suburb of Sant Andreu, which was
formerly the Fabra i Coats factory.
The site, selected by Oriol Clos, Barcelona City’s head of urbanism,
will challenge the undergraduates to address challenges such as; the
relationships between old and new, appropriate use of site planning
to provide both cultural and community buildings, and the generation
of new design ideas to transform the site into a public urban space.
Students will have 10 minutes to present their ideas to a judging
panel, which includes British Professor David Dunster of Liverpool
University and Barcelona architect David Mackay, on Thursday 23rd
October. Visitors at the Festival can watch the judging on Thursday
afternoon. The winner will be announced at the Festival Awards
Ceremony on Friday evening.
